If we ask about most worst inflation spell which country had to face in the history, the one that will always come in our mind is Germany during the Weimar Republic, it started in October 1923 when the wholesale prices increased by twenty nine thousand five hundred percent as the price of bread in 1922 was 163 and in 1923 it was 1.5 billion prices was double by every 3 days they ongoing printed the money but soon they realized that the worth of currency was vanished. After being passed from traumatic era the clashed the old currency and get a new one which take along the value of currency again. But now Germany count up in developed countries of the world.
